What was the earliest form of a jet plane in WWII?

The Messerschmitt Me 262 was the first operational jet fighter, manufactured by Germany during World War II and entering service on 19 April 1944 with Erprobungskommando 262 at Lechfeld just south of Augsburg.

When was the first jet used in war?

World War II was the first war in which jet aircraft participated in combat with examples being used on both sides of the conflict during the latter stages of the war. The first successful jet aircraft, the Heinkel He 178, flew only five days before the start of the war, on 1 September 1939.

Did the Japanese have jets in WW2?

The Nakajima Kikka (中島 橘花, “Orange Blossom”) was Japan’s first jet aircraft. It was developed late in World War II and the first prototype had only flown once before the end of the conflict.

Did the Tuskegee Airmen shoot down jets?

The Tuskegee Airmen shot down three German jets in a single day. Pilots Charles Brantley, Earl Lane and Roscoe Brown all shot down German jets over Berlin that day. For the mission, the 332nd Fighter Group earned a Distinguished Unit Citation.
